Output ea2189dabbd958255a542a1569bd20ad5b73048ba6a784dc0e6eab8ba9c50eeb:0

value
14130530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aebc5367299de9f8413275dc450e56861dbafbb OP_EQUAL
address
3FpARhQvUCTjoajbxhJxrMjs8kNLXoYe9R
transaction
ea2189dabbd958255a542a1569bd20ad5b73048ba6a784dc0e6eab8ba9c50eeb
confirmations
295737
spent
true